Tomatillo Salsa //
Here’s what you’ll need:
- 1 bunch cilantro
- 8 tomatillos, cut into quarters
- 2 green heirloom tomatoes, cut into quarters
- 2 cloves garlic
- 1 jalapeno, seeded removed + chopped
- 3 limes, juices
- 1 white onion, chopped
- 1 teaspoon salt
Here’s what you do:
Grab the food processor.
Throw all the ingredients in and blend till smooth.
Add a little more salt if needed.
Pop in the fridge for a couple of hours. Better if you can leave it overnight.

Crispy Cheese Taco Shells //
Here’s what you’ll need:
- 8 oz pre-shredded sharp cheddar cheese
Yep, that’s it!
Here’s what you’ll do:
Preheat oven to 375 degrees.
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.
Dig through your bowls and find one that is about 6 inches. Trace it onto the parchment paper.
Measure 1/3 cup shredded cheese and place in the traced circle. Spread it out.
Place one pan on the lower rack and the other on the upper rack of the oven.
Bake for 5 minutes and swap pans from lower to upper/ upper to lower.
Bake 5-10 minutes. Watching for little holes to appear on the cheese and the edges will begin to brown.
Remove from oven. Gently remove with a spatula and drape over a wooden spoon suspended by two glasses. Check out the image. The description sounds funny.
Cool and stuff with your families favorite taco meat + toppings. It’s the perfect low carb taco holder.
Look at those tacos. Makes my mouth water!
These could be made into cups using muffin tins. Or how about tostada shells, by just leaving them flat. How about jazzing them up with some herbs? The options are endless.
